According to the data from the years 2003 - 2018 the average number of fire incidents per year is 10. The highest number of reported fire incidents - 46 took place in 2018, and the least - 1 in 2004. The data has a growing trend.
31.5% incidents where reported in the morning and 68.5% in the evening. The most fires (19.4%) took place on Friday, and the least (9.1%) on Monday.
According to the 165 reports from years 2003 - 2018 most fires (11.5%) took place during May, and the least (4.2%) in July.
Out of all 379 cases reported during the years 2003 - 2018, the most belonged to the categories: Fire (43.5%), Rescue & EMS (20.6%), and Hazardous Condition (14.8%).
When looking into fire subcategories, the most incidents belonged to: Structure Fires (63.6%), and Mobile Property/Vehicle Fires (20.6%).
